one should be able to see what day it is that the calendar is diplaying,
without having to refer back to the monthly calendar.
I.E. display the day alongside to the date at the top of the window.
Vince Averello [MVP-Outlook] - 21 Jun 2005 02:12 GMT
It will if your long date format includes the day name here: Control Panel >
Regional Settings applet > Date tab
